tensorflow:: ops:: MatrixSetDiag
#include <array_ops.h>
Returns a batched matrix tensor with new batched diagonal values.
Summary
Given input and diagonal, this operation returns a tensor with the same shape and values as input, except for the main diagonal of the innermost matrices. These will be overwritten by the values in diagonal.
The output is computed as follows:
Assume input has k+1 dimensions [I, J, K, ..., M, N] and diagonal has k dimensions [I, J, K, ..., min(M, N)]. Then the output is a tensor of rank k+1 with dimensions [I, J, K, ..., M, N] where:
output[i, j, k, ..., m, n] = diagonal[i, j, k, ..., n]form == n.output[i, j, k, ..., m, n] = input[i, j, k, ..., m, n]form != n.
Args:
- scope: A Scope object
- input: Rank
k+1, wherek >= 1. - diagonal: Rank
k, wherek >= 1.
Returns:
Output: Rankk+1, withoutput.shape = input.shape.
